In this week’s gospel we see Jesus retreating into gentile territory for a while, to take a break
from endless confrontation with the Pharisees, and to let things cool down a bit. While he is there a
woman (we know from Mark, a Greek woman of social standing) begs Jesus to cure her daughter,
who is tormented by a demon. Perhaps because he is in gentile territory Jesus makes clear his own
standing as Messiah – he comes first for the people of Israel; they must be fed before the “dogs” of
the household. The word used for dogs here indicates little pet dogs – so he is actually being more
tender than we at first realise, but he is testing the woman’s faith nevertheless.
She comes through with flying colours. With real humility she persists in begging mercy from the
man she believes to be the Messiah and her prayer is answered. Jesus found faith amongst the
pagans that often he did not find amongst his own people. Let’s not think that because we’re
Catholics we are entitled to God’s privileged attention – there may be others, outside the Church,
whose humility and simplicity of heart bring them an enviable closeness to God.
Fr David
